The urgent need for environmental solutions has propelled climate technology into the spotlight as a critical force for achieving a sustainable future. Climate technology, also known as clean or green technology, encompasses innovative solutions aimed at reducing greenhouse gas emissions, promoting renewable energy, enhancing energy efficiency, and addressing various facets of climate change. It represents a diverse range of technological advancements and applications designed to mitigate environmental impact and foster a more sustainable relationship between humanity and the planet.

One of the most promising areas within climate technology is the transition to renewable energy sources. Solar, wind, hydro, and geothermal energy offer clean alternatives to traditional fossil fuels, significantly reducing emissions from electricity generation. Advances in these technologies have made them increasingly efficient and cost-effective, driving their widespread adoption. For instance, solar panels capture sunlight and convert it into electricity through photovoltaic cells, while wind turbines harness the kinetic energy of wind to generate power. As renewable energy technologies continue to mature, they are poised to play a central role in decarbonizing the energy sector and achieving a sustainable energy future.

Beyond renewable energy, climate technology encompasses a broad spectrum of solutions across various sectors. Energy efficiency technologies are crucial for optimizing energy use and minimizing waste. These technologies include smart grids, which optimize electricity distribution and consumption using data, and energy-efficient building designs that reduce energy consumption through advanced insulation and smart glass. Carbon capture and storage (CCS) technologies offer another avenue for mitigating emissions by capturing carbon dioxide from industrial processes and storing it underground, preventing it from entering the atmosphere. Sustainable transportation solutions, such as electric vehicles and public transportation, are essential for reducing emissions from the transportation sector.

Green agriculture techniques, including precision agriculture and sustainable farming practices, contribute to reducing the environmental impact of food production. Precision agriculture utilizes GPS, satellite positioning, and agricultural drones to manage crop and livestock production efficiently, reducing land and water use. Circular economy initiatives promote resource efficiency by emphasizing recycling, reuse, and waste reduction, minimizing the need for virgin materials and reducing waste generation.

Em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I), blockchain, and quantum computing are also playing an increasingly significant role in climate technology. AI can optimize energy consumption, track carbon emissions, and develop new materials for carbon capture technologies. Blockchain technology can enhance transparency and accountability in environmental initiatives, while quantum computing can accelerate the development of new materials for energy storage and carbon capture. The Internet of Things (IoT) enables the creation of smart farms that can be monitored and automated in real-time, optimizing resource utilization and reducing waste.

The development and deployment of climate technologies face several challenges, including the need for significant investments in research and development, infrastructure, and deployment. Overcoming these barriers requires collaborative efforts from governments, businesses, and individuals. Governments can incentivize investments in renewable energy through subsidies and tax benefits. Businesses can adopt sustainable technologies and incorporate circular design concepts into their supply chains. Individuals can reduce their carbon footprint by making sustainable choices in their daily lives, such as using public transport, conserving energy, and reducing waste.
